Subject: [PATCH 3/4] arm64: dts: apple: Add chassis-type property for Mac
Pro
The tower and rack mount Mac Pro variants share the same .dts file and
are identical except for the chassis. There doesn't appear to be a
property in Apple's device tree to distinguish these two devices so use
"server" as chassis type which describes both if one doesn't look too
carefully.
